What Does a Sink Water Softener Do?

A sink water softener is a compact device that treats water directly at the point of use—your kitchen or bathroom sink. It employs ion exchange technology to swap out calcium and magnesium ions, which cause hardness, with sodium or potassium ions. This process results in softer water that is more pleasant to drink, easier to clean with, and reduces mineral buildup on fixtures and appliances. Softened water also improves soap lathering, making household chores more efficient.

Maintenance and Upkeep

Maintaining your sink water softener is simple. It generally involves regularly refilling the salt or potassium chloride, checking system for leaks, and occasional regeneration cycles as needed.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ance, prolongs equipment lifespan, and keeps your water tasting fresh and free of mineral deposits.

Signs the Current Setup is Failing

If your water softening system is not functioning as it should, several telltale signs may indicate its inefficiency. In Sierra City, CA, one prominent symptom is the presence of mineral deposits on faucets, showerheads, and dishes. If you notice a chalky buildup that is difficult to clean, it's a clear sign that hardness minerals are not being adequately removed. Additionally, if your water tastes unpleasant or has a metallic flavor, this could mean that levels of calcium and magnesium remain high, impacting the overall quality of your drinking water.

Another indicator includes changes in soap performance; if soaps and detergents fail to lather as they used to, it might suggest that your water is still hard.
